The SCOPE Story
SCOPE has supported individuals with developmental disabilities for over 30 years. Our core departments support children, youth, and families (Outreach), adults with mental health diagnoses (Community Support Team), and Seniors (Journeys). The Community Development department facilitates advocacy efforts (Disability Commons - formerly Disability Action Hall) and hosts the Picture This Film Festival.
Individuals served by SCOPE enjoy a flexible program and service that is customized according to their own preferences and needs. One size does not fit all, and every individual is entitled to pursue their dreams and goals on their terms. Person-centred planning is the cornerstone of SCOPE’s values and services.
SCOPE is a leader in the community of disability services, specializing in creative ways of helping individuals live full lives in a community setting regardless of their level of need. Its services are frequently sought for a smaller proportion of individuals who have had repeated unsuccessful placements or chronic hospitalization.
We believe that the best services are based in relationship; our role is to create services that work for the individual.
Our Mission
The SCOPE Society of Alberta works in alliance with people with disabilities, their families and friends, and other community members to understand problems and create solutions to personal and social justice issues.
Guiding Principles:
Support individuals to live as they choose
Use positive, kind, and caring approaches
Recognize and celebrate our diversity
Create places where people can be themselves
Support equal rights and responsibilities for everyone in our community
Promote physical, mental, economic, and emotional well-being
Listen to each other, learn from our experiences, and make changes
Be aware of power and privilege and how it affects our actions
